Hogyan gyorsítsuk fel a WordPress webhelyet a CDN77 segítségével

Előző cikkünkben feltártuk a CDN szolgáltatásnak a WordPress használatával járó előnyeit és azt, hogy a CDN-k miért az egyik legjobb módszer a WordPress felgyorsítására a blogban. . Megfigyeltük, hogy a teljesítmény mennyire növekszik, ha a látogatók távol vannak a gazdaszervertől. Reméljük, hogy ez felkeltette érdeklődését, mert a mai cikkben lépésről lépésre készítünk útmutatást arról, hogyan lehet CDN-erőforrást létrehozni a CDN77-en, és hogyan kell azt megfelelő módon módosítani. Ezután telepítünk egy konkrét bővítményt a WordPress-re, majd ellenőrizni fogjuk, hogy minden jól működik-e.


Útmutatónk első lépése az lesz hozzon létre egy CDN77 fiókot. Ha még nem rendelkezik fiókkal, A CDN77 ingyenes 14 napos próbaverziót kínál. A regisztráció csak néhány percig tart. Akkor valójában létrehozunk egy CDN-erőforrást az Új CDN-erőforrás létrehozása elemre kattintással (a CDN fül alatt). E cikk alkalmazásában CDN-t fogunk telepíteni egy filmblogban, amelyet egy Las Vegas-i Datacenter üzemeltet..

cdn77-with-wordpress-03

Mivel a teljes HTTPS megoldást fogjuk megvalósítani, az új „HTTPS” -t fogjuk használni a CDN77-en. Ez az opció biztosítja az adatátvitelt a gazdaszervertől a CDN-kiszolgálóra.

Ha webhelye SSL módban fut, akkor feltétlenül létre kell hoznia a csak SSL erőforrást a CDN77 webhelyen. Ellenkező esetben kockázatot jelenthet a vegyes tartalommal. Ez a fajta hiba akkor fordul elő, amikor a böngésző SSL módban fut, és hirtelen megkísérel betölteni egy erőforrást egy nem biztonságos HTTP kéréssel.

cdn77-with-wordpress-04

Hogyan állítsunk be SSL-t a CDN77-en

Kétféle módon állíthatunk be ingyenes SSL-tanúsítványt. Használhatunk egy megosztott SSL-igazolást egy aldomain számára az xxx.c.cdn77.org címen, vagy saját CNAME -ünket is (lásd a fenti képet). Általában azt javasoljuk, hogy használjon olyan CNAME-t, mint a cdn.yoursite.com.

Ha a CDN77 megosztott megoldást választja, az SSL aldomain megfelelő működéséhez nincs szükség további lépésekre.

Ebben az esetben beállítunk egy CNAME-t. Ez azt jelenti, hogy webhelyünk tartalma azonnal elérhető lesz a HTTPS-en keresztül, ha webhelyünket a cdn.ourdomain helyébe lépjük. A CDN77 esetén az SSL megszerzése néhány kattintás kérdése.

Csípje be !

Az erőforrás létrehozása után az első dolog, amelyet meg kell nézni, a Egyéb beállítások menü. Ha HTTPS-t fog használni, akkor feltétlenül kötelező a HTTP / 2 engedélyezése. A sebesség javulása a normál HTTP / 1.x és a HTTP / 2 között óriási. A CDN77 alapértelmezés szerint HTTP / 2 módban fog működni a HTTPS erőforrásban, és felére csökkenti az idejét.

Ha HTTPS-en keresztül megy, akkor a 301-es átirányítást is meg kell tennie, hogy megfeleljen a google HTTPS-szabványoknak, engedélyezze a HTTPS-átirányítást.

Az optimális teljesítmény elérése érdekében engedélyezze az összes figyelmen kívül hagyását a Lekérdezés karakterláncok ignore-ben. Hacsak a webhely nem működik dinamikusan betöltött tartalommal, amelyet óránként frissíteni kell, akkor megszabadulhat a lekérdezési karakterláncoktól, és figyelmen kívül hagyhatja az összeset, ez óriási mértékben növeli a gyorsítótár és a webhely teljesítményét.

A CDN77 a Cache lejárati lehetőséget is kínálja. Ha sok képet tölt be, akkor azt a lehető legmagasabbra kell állítani, amely 12 nap.

Ebben az útmutatóban elsősorban a sebességet vesszük figyelembe. A CDN ennélfogva csak a statikus képi tartalmat fogja nyújtani nekünk, minden más az eredeti szerverről lesz betöltve.

Miért nem használnád a CDN-t a Javascripthez és a CSS-hez??

Ne feledje, az előző cikkben arról beszéltünk, hogy a CDN teljesítménye változhat, ha a tartalom nem érhető el a CDN hálózat kért csomópontján. Nos, ha a még nem tárolt fájl CSS fájl lesz, akkor a betöltési idő növekszik, és ez negatív hatással lehet a teljesítményre. Ez sokkal befolyásolhatja webhelyének megjelenítési sebességét, mint ha úgy dönt, hogy nem szolgáltatja a CSS-t a CDN-sel.

A CSS és a Javascript fájlok nélkülözhetetlenek a weboldalak bármilyen böngészőhöz történő betöltéséhez, és nem szabad olyan gyorsítótár-mechanizmus tárgyát képezni, mint amilyen a CDN-szolgáltatásokban. Ennek ellenére statikus erőforrást hozhat létre a CDN-re a fontos fájlok lerakásához. Ez egy fejlettebb technika, amely megköveteli, hogy a WordPress-t a jelen oktatóprogram keretein kívülre állítsa.

Miután mindent megfelelően megvizsgáltunk, folytathatjuk az adatközpontok menülapját.

cdn77-with-wordpress-07

A CDN77 kényelmes módot kínál a hálózat minden csomópontjának engedélyezésére / letiltására. A lényeg az, hogy gondosan válasszuk ki, mely csomópontokat használjuk a legaktívabban. Ezt könnyű megtudni, csak kövesse olvasóit.

Miután megtudta, hogy mely csomópontokra van szüksége, javasoljuk, hogy kapcsolja ki az összes szükségtelen csomópontot. Erre egy egyszerű magyarázat van: minél több csomópont van a hálózatán, annál több időt vesz igénybe az összes frissítés, tehát a teljesítményed szenved. Általános szabály, hogy amikor csökkenti a csomópontok számát, akkor a gyorsítótár teljesítményét is növeli. Válassz bölcsen.

Amikor először teszteli webhelyének teljesítményét, megtisztítás és előzetes letöltés hasznos lehet. A tisztítás egy adott tartalmat kiszorít a CDN hálózatából, ez hasznos, ha megváltoztatja a tartalmat, és a frissítéshez ki kell ürítenie a gyorsítótárat. Az előhívás az ellenkezőjét fogja elérni, és egy adott tartalmat kényszerít a CDN gyorsítótárba.

cdn77-a-wordpress-10

Miután minden konfigurálva van, a CNAME-t a saját domainjére mutathatja. Ehhez létre kell hoznia egy szabályt a regisztrátorban vagy a host panelen a DNS szakaszban, és a cdn.magy domain domain.com-t a CNAME xxx.rsc.cdn77.org fájlra kell mutatnia, ahogy az a képen látható, ez utasítja a DNS-t az aldomain összes forgalmának a tényleges helyre irányításához. Ne aggódjon, ez nem befolyásolja a teljesítményt. Ezenkívül arra is szolgál, hogy megmutassa az olvasóinak, hogy Ön a cdn.yourdomain.com ami fantasztikusnak tűnik.

Ha inkább a cdn77.org címet használja, akkor nem kell tennie semmit, csak használja ezt a címet, amikor a tartalmát a WordPress-ben cseréli.

WordPress oldal

A WordPress oldalán be kell építenünk egy plugint, hogy ez a megfelelő módon működjön. Fogjuk használni a CDN engedélyezõ, egy praktikus ingyenes bővítmény. A plugin használatának oka egyszerű – a CDN pluginok többsége nem engedi meg a CDN-hez elküldött mappák ilyen részletességű ellenőrzését. Ez a plugin igen, és ez nagyon fontos a mi esetünk számára, mivel nem akarunk Javascript vagy CSS fájlokat, csak a feltöltött képeket belefoglalni.

cdn77-with-wordpress-14

A telepítés után itt található a plugin …

cdn77-a-wordpress-15

Csináljuk meg !

cdn77-a-wordpress-16

Emlékszel, amikor beszélgettünk a testreszabásról? Itt van a legfontosabb tény a CDN megfelelő beállításáról a WordPress-en. A CDN beépülő modulok túlnyomó többsége azt fogja mondani, hogy adjon meg egy könyvtárat a CDN számára, hogy „replikálódjon”, és általában azt mondják, hogy tartalmazzon wp-tartalmat. Ez jó az általános beállításnál, de nem jó a teljesítményéhez, mert a wp-tartalom mappát egy másik nagyon érzékeny mappa, a plugins és témák mappa töltötte meg, beleértve rengeteg Javascript és CSS fájlt. Elveszítheti a teljesítményét, ha nem vannak tárolva a korábban tárgyalt módon.

Szóval, hogyan tudjuk ezt megjavítani? Egyszerűen belefoglaljuk a wp-content / feltöltések mappáját. Egy ilyen egyszerű megoldás!

Bármilyen megdöbbentő is, a CDN-ket kezelő pluginek túlnyomó többsége nem teszi lehetővé ezt. Ha kizárólag ezt az almappát tartalmazza, akkor a CDN meghívja a feltöltési mappába, azaz csak a képeket.

cdn77-a-wordpress-17

A webhely egyszerű frissítésével a CDN megkaphatja a tartalmat az Ön számára. Ebben a példában megnyitottuk a Firefox Fejlesztő lapot (F12) és kerestük az első képet. Világosan láthatja, hogy a link lecserélődött, és most közvetlenül a CDN-ből töltik be, nem pedig a gazdaszerverünkre!

Előtt és után

Lássuk, hogy mindez kiderült !

A bal oldali képernyőn láthatjuk a webhely Svédországból való betöltéséhez szükséges időt (ami messze van a Las Vegas-i host szervertől, emlékszel?). A jobb oldali képernyőn láthatjuk, hogy a teljesítmény javult, az idő majdnem felére vágva! Az összes alapvető fájl továbbra is betöltődik a Las Vegas-i szerverünkről, de a nehéz terhelésű fájlok, például a képek a svédországi csomópontból töltődnek be..

Csomagolás fel

Remélhetőleg megtanulta a CDN beépítésének hatékony módszerét a WordPress webhelyén. Egyes technikák nem beavatkozók, például a CSS és Javascript fájlok, amelyek nélkülözhetetlenek a webhely betöltési sebességéhez. Most kihasználhatja a CDN minden előnyeit, és ezzel egyidejűleg minimalizálhatja annak hátrányait. Reméljük, hogy eljuttatja az ingyenes CDN próbaverziót, és felhasználja az e cikkben szereplő tippeket, hogy meg tudja gyorsítani a WordPress webhelyet. Reméljük, hogy tetszett a cikk! Mint általában, minden kérdést vagy kétséget hagyjon az alábbi megjegyzésekben.

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map